@@ -113,7 +113,7 @@ jobs:
113113 Install-Module -Name Pester -Repository PSGallery -Force -Scope CurrentUser -MaximumVersion $PesterMaxVersion -SkipPublisherCheck -AllowClobber
114114 Import-Module Pester -Force -PassThru -MaximumVersion $PesterMaxVersion} @Parameters
115115 - name : Check out repository
116- uses : actions/checkout@v2
116+ uses : actions/checkout@v4
117117 - name : RunPester
118118 id : RunPester
119119 shell : pwsh
@@ -170,9 +170,6 @@ jobs:
170170 $result =
171171 Invoke-Pester -PassThru -Verbose -OutputFile ".\$moduleName.TestResults.xml" -OutputFormat NUnitXml @codeCoverageParameters
172172
173- "::set-output name=TotalCount::$($result.TotalCount)",
174- "::set-output name=PassedCount::$($result.PassedCount)",
175- "::set-output name=FailedCount::$($result.FailedCount)" | Out-Host
176173 if ($result.FailedCount -gt 0) {
177174 "::debug:: $($result.FailedCount) tests failed"
178175 foreach ($r in $result.TestResult) {
@@ -184,7 +181,7 @@ jobs:
184181 }
185182 } @Parameters
186183 - name : PublishTestResults
187- uses : actions/upload-artifact@v2
184+ uses : actions/upload-artifact@v3
188185 with :
189186 name : PesterResults
190187 path : ' **.TestResults.xml'
@@ -578,11 +575,8 @@ jobs:
578575 - name : Use PSSVG Action
579576 uses : StartAutomating/PSSVG@main
580577 id : PSSVG
581- - name : PipeScript
578+ - name : BuildPipeScript
582579 uses : StartAutomating/PipeScript@main
583- id : PipeScript
584- with :
585- serial : true
586580 - name : UseEZOut
587581 uses : StartAutomating/EZOut@master
588582 - name : Use GitPub Action
0 commit comments